Kelsey Schulman, MSW, LICSW

ABOUT

Hello, I’m Kelsey Schulman (they/them).  I received my Masters in Social Work from The University of Washington in 2018 specializing in mental health and have worked in a variety of community mental health and non-profit settings since 2014. My roles have included psychotherapist, group healing facilitator, and advocate working with survivors of trauma of all identities from emerging adults up to older adults. I’m passionate about liberation for all people, and I believe therapy is a place to work towards becoming more free.

I use an eclectic approach that integrates modalities such as DBT, ACT, Somatics, Mindfulness and EMDR to address the various challenges that clients face throughout their lifespan. I enjoy bringing a sense playfulness and using humor (when appropriate) in my work as we plant seeds of change and cultivate growth as a team. I am most passionate about working with the LGBTQIA community, specifically with queer and trans clients.

I believe that therapy is a co-created space where healing takes place. I use a clinical approach that is strengths-based, trauma-informed, and client-centered to support you in building the life you wish to live. I approach each client with warmth and positive regard as we work together to challenge patterns that are no longer serving you and to deepen your well of joy.

Through an anti-oppressive framework I offer a space to explore life’s up’s and downs by building on each person’s inherent resilience’s and resources to create lasting change. I work with people experiencing anxiety, depression, relationship issues, grief and loss, major life transitions, ADHD, Autism, PTSD, and intergenerational trauma and trauma from living in racialized capitalism and harm from systems of oppression. I also enjoy working with polyamorous clients. I am experienced in working with people from a diverse religious, ethnic, racial, socioeconomic backgrounds and clients from all sexual orientations and gender identities.
